Pokemon Go offers a plethora of events for its users, each providing you with limited-time bonuses and special features. This includes Spotlight Hours, 60-minute windows where they feature a specific Pokemon and offer bonuses to accompany it.

This week's Spotlight Hour will showcase Hoppip, the Cottonweed Pokemon, and offer several bonuses.

Hoppip has two further evolutions, Skiploom and Jumpluff. It will require 25 Hoppip Candy to evolve Hoppip into Skiploom, then another 100 Hoppip Candy to evolve Skiploom into Jumpluff, its final evolution.

Hoppip Candy can be acquired by catching, hatching, or transferring Hoppip, Skiploom, or Jumpluff.

Also, as with any Spotlight Hour, this is a great chance to catch a Hoppip with high in-game stats. Although Hoppip's stats are still random when caught, the sheer number of Hoppip encounters will give you a greater opportunity to catch one with desirable stats.

A specific bonus will accompany each Spotlight Hour throughout its duration, and Hoppip's will be no different. For this Spotlight Hour, you will receive two times the Candy when catching Pokemon.

With the massive increase in Hoppip spawns during this event window, this is a great opportunity to catch several of these Pokemon, providing you with tons of Hoppip Candy, a valuable resource used to evolve and power-up Hoppip, Skiploom, and Jumpluff.

To maximize this double catch Candy bonus, it is best if you are in an area populated with plenty of PokeStops. This will not only increase the amount of Hoppip that you encounter, but it will also allow you to constantly obtain Poke Balls and other resources.

The main bonus of this Spotlight Hour will be Hoppip's massively increased spawn rate during this event. The spawn rate of this Pokemon can be increased further by using both PokeStop Lures and Incense.

After using an Incense, do your best to move around and travel distance.

This will increase the overall effectiveness of Incense, providing you with even more Hoppip encounters.

Fortunately, you will have the chance to encounter Hoppip's Shiny variation during this Spotlight Hour Event. Using these two items will help increase the odds of you encountering and catching this unique Hoppip variant.

Similar to Community Day Events, the increased spawn rate of Hoppip will give you decent odds of finding and catching this Shiny Pokemon, so make sure that you prepare accordingly when it comes to your items and specific locations.

That being said, Hoppip's Shiny rates will not be boosted for this Spotlight Hour.

This means that encountering a Shiny Hoppip will still be rare and often hard to come by.

How To Prepare For Spotlight Hours

Three PokeBalls from Pokemon Go

With such a short window, ensuring that you are prepared for this event before its commencement is important. With the massive increase in the featured Pokemon's spawn rate, make sure you are stocked up on Poke Balls.

You will also want to ensure that you have sufficient Pokemon Storage before this event begins. This will allow you to quickly catch the featured Pokemon without worrying about transferring others to make space.

You can also increase your Pokemon Storage by 50 by purchasing a Pokemon Storage Upgrade at the in-game shop for 200 PokeCoins.

With the bonus of this Spotlight Hour being double Candy for catching any Pokemon, stocking up on Poke Balls and having sufficient storage is especially important.

Lastly, with Hoppip being a Grass and Flying dual-type Pokemon, Mega Evolve a Pokemon that is either a Grass or Flying-type during this Spotlight Hour. This will further increase the number of Candies earned when catching Hoppip throughout this event.

Additionally, this will increase the chances of obtaining Hoppip Candy XL, a resource required to power-up Hoppip, Skiploom, and Jumpluff to their maximum levels.

The higher the Mega Evolution's Mega Level is, the more effective this added Candy bonus will be.
